Advertisement

构建社会科学领域特定术语词典。

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
包含社会科学领域特定术语的词典,该词典总共收录了三十一万个词汇,每个词汇占据一行,且确保所有词汇之间不出现重复。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 制的汇表
    优质
    《定制的社会科学词汇表》是一本为社会科学学习者和研究者量身定做的专业术语指南,涵盖经济学、政治学等多领域核心概念,助力深入理解与交流。 社会科学相关自定义词典,包含31万个词语,每个词占一行且无重复项。
  • 工程生成器——生成器
    优质
    社工词典生成器是一款专为网络安全领域设计的工具,能够帮助用户快速生成针对特定目标的社会工程学词汇表,增强渗透测试和安全培训的效果。 亦思想社会工程学字典生成器,可放心使用。
  • 中文
    优质
    中文领域的特定语言聚焦于探讨中文这一独特的语言系统在语法、词汇及语用学等层面的特点和规律。它涵盖从古汉语到现代汉语的发展脉络,并深入分析方言与普通话之间的差异,以及中文在网络时代的演变趋势。同时,此领域还关注跨文化交流中中文的独特作用及其在全球化背景下的地位变化。 在多个领域中使用抽象且统一的特定领域语言来描述设计概要并进行表示。
  • 言实战技巧
    优质
    《领域特定语言实战技巧》一书深入浅出地讲解了DSL的设计与实现方法,涵盖多种应用场景和案例分析,帮助读者掌握DSL开发的核心技能。 《领域专用语言实战》一书不仅教你如何使用DSL解决问题,还会详细介绍实现DSL的方法。书中认为,DSL是围绕语义模型构建的一层薄薄的语言抽象,其中语义模型负责体现领域的核心结构,而语言层面则采用特定于该领域的术语表达方式。 本书将通过Ruby、Groovy、Scala和Clojure等现代编程语言讲解如何设计与实施DSL,并深入探讨不同编程范式在DSL实现中的优缺点。阅读完这本书后,你将对一些关键概念有深刻的理解,并能够创造出既易于领域用户理解和欣赏的优雅抽象解决方案。
  • 言(Domain Specific Languages)
    优质
    特定领域的语言(DSL)是指用于解决某一领域问题的专用编程语言或元语言,旨在提高该领域内软件开发效率和可维护性。 《领域特定语言》是DSL领域的经典之作,由软件开发大师Martin Fowler耗时多年精心撰写,并经ThoughtWorks中国团队翻译为高清英文PDF版。 本书全面而详细地介绍了各种DSL的构造方式及其应用原理,揭示了与编程语言无关的核心原则和模式。书中阐释了如何通过使用领域特定语言(DSL)来提高开发者的工作效率以及改善他们与业务专家之间的沟通效果。此外,该书还提供了有关选择和实施DSL的有效决策依据和技术指导。 全书共包括57章,并分为六个部分: - 第一部分:介绍了什么是DSL、其用途及构造方法;解释了如何实现外部DSL和内部DSL、代码生成以及语言工作台的使用。 - 第二部分:深入探讨各种DSL,涵盖了语义模型、符号表、上下文变量等概念及其应用案例。 - 第三部分:详细讲解语法分析技术如分隔符指导翻译、BNF(巴科斯范式)、正则表达式的词法解析器和递归下降方法的使用场景及工作原理。 - 第四部分:探讨了表达式生成器、函数序列等高级编程技巧,以及如何利用它们来改进DSL的设计与实现。 - 第五部分:介绍了多种计算模型的应用及其实践意义,如适应性模型、决策表、依赖网络和产生式规则系统等。 - 第六部分:讨论了一些代码生成技术的细节及其实现方法,包括基于转换器的方式、模板化生成器以及无模式化的代码生成策略。 通过阅读本书,读者可以获得关于DSL设计与实现的重要见解,并学习如何在实际项目中有效地运用这些知识。
  • 优质
    《医学术语词典》是一部全面收录医学领域专业词汇的工具书,涵盖临床、基础医学等多个方面,旨在为医学生、医护人员及科研人员提供精准、权威的医学知识查询服务。 压缩包内包含两部分内容:疾病词汇(3557个),症状词汇(4259个)。
  • 自然
    优质
    《自然科学定制词典》是一部专为科学爱好者及专业人士打造的权威工具书,涵盖了物理学、化学、生物学等领域的核心概念和最新研究成果。 在自然科学领域内共有34万个不同的词汇。
  • 使用jieba进行年报可读性分析所需的(包含两个灵格斯目和等)
    优质
    本项目旨在利用jieba分词工具对年报文本进行深入解析,通过整合外语学习软件灵格斯中的财务相关词汇与专门定制的会计科目及术语词库,增强文档可读性分析能力。 利用jieba进行年报可读性分析所需词典的构建包括两个灵格斯词典、会计科目词汇表、会计术语列表以及连词词典。这些资源有助于提高文本处理的质量,使财务报告更加易于理解。
  • 利用Assistants API迅速的AI助手
    优质
    本简介介绍如何使用Assistants API快速开发针对特定领域的智能助手,简化复杂任务,提高效率和用户体验。 ### 使用Assistants API快速搭建领域专属AI助手 #### 一、什么是Assistants API? Assistants API是由OpenAI于2023年11月7日首次在其开发者大会(Dev Day)上发布的全新API服务,为开发人员提供了一个强大的工具集来构建高度定制化的AI助手。其核心功能包括: - **模型集成**:利用先进的预训练模型。 - **执行代码**:支持执行用户提供的代码片段以进行更复杂的逻辑处理。 - **读取外部知识**:可以从外部数据库或文档中检索信息。 - **使用外部能力**:集成第三方服务来增强AI助手的功能。 - **持久化**:确保会话历史被保存,以便在后续交互中使用。 通过官方提供的Web界面和丰富的官方文档,开发人员可以轻松体验并调试API。 #### 二、为什么选择Assistants API? Assistants API具有以下显著优势: 1. **全面性**:提供了一套完整的解决方案,涵盖了从基础对话到复杂任务处理的各种需求。 2. **速度**:借助高效的API调用和内置的性能优化机制,使得响应时间更短,用户体验更好。 3. **简单易用**:设计注重用户体验,即使是没有深度学习背景的开发人员也能快速上手。 4. **个性化**:允许用户自定义助手风格以满足不同场景下的特定需求。 #### 三、Demo展示及能力介绍 ##### 1. **Retrieval & Function call & Code interpreter** 在演示中展示了Assistants API的强大功能,包括检索功能、函数调用以及代码解释器。这些功能使得AI助手不仅能够进行简单的问答交互,还能执行复杂的逻辑操作。 ##### 2. **Streamlit简介** Streamlit是一款用于构建和分享数据应用的框架,以其简洁高效著称。开发人员只需编写Python代码即可快速搭建出美观实用的应用程序。 - **核心概念与编程范式**:包括数据流、展示数据的命令(如`st.write()`)以及各种Widgets组件。 - **开发流程**:从创建项目开始,不断编写、保存和重新运行代码以完成整个应用程序的开发。 #### 四、从Demo到实际应用的Gap 尽管Assistants API提供了强大的功能和支持,在将其应用于真实场景时仍存在一些挑战: 1. **安全问题**:现有的Demo未涉及对敏感信息的安全处理。 2. **模型局限性**:目前仅支持OpenAI通用模型,可能无法满足某些特定领域的专业需求。 3. **RAG(Retrieve-Augment-Generate)相关问题** - 成本较高,尤其是对于大量数据的需求。 - 有一定的使用限制,如每个Assistant每天的文件数量和大小限制。 - 缺乏透明度,在检索和分割策略的具体实现方面不清楚。 4. **扩展性和可维护性**:现有的Demo框架较为简单,可能不适合大规模应用长期维护和发展。 5. **数据连接与记忆功能**:缺乏有效连接外部数据源的能力,并且无法管理会话历史。 #### 结语 尽管存在上述挑战,通过合理的规划和设计,我们可以充分利用Assistants API的优势开发出既符合业务需求又具有良好用户体验的AI助手。随着技术进步和API不断完善,这些问题有望得到解决,为用户提供更加智能化的服务。
  • 利用Xtext和Xtend言(第2版)-中文-第四章.pdf
    优质
    本书第二版提供了使用Xtext和Xtend构建领域特定语言(DSL)的详细指南。第四章深入讲解了如何通过这些工具来开发和定制DSL,为开发者提供了一个强大的框架以简化软件开发过程中的建模工作。 本章将深入探讨如何使用Xtext与Xtend实现域特定语言(DSL)的验证功能。在DSL开发过程中,验证至关重要,因为它允许实时检查并报告错误及警告,确保代码符合既定规则。 Xtext的验证机制基于“验证器”这一核心概念,它使开发者能够添加额外约束检查,在解析阶段无法完成这些检查。通过与Xtext通信,开发者可以定义可能的错误和警告,并在IDE中以错误标记形式呈现给用户。此过程后台运行,确保即时反馈。 我们将了解Xtext验证的基础知识。默认情况下,Xtext提供了几个验证器,例如用于防止重复实体名称的“NamesAreUniqueValidator”。这类默认验证器检查每个类型的元素名称是否唯一(如属性和实体)。不过,请注意,它不会对同一命名空间内的元素进行严格唯一的性检查;即两个不同实体可以拥有相同名称的属性。如果需要更严格的约束,则需自定义`NamesAreUniqueValidator`或创建新的验证器。 要启用Xtext默认验证器,在MWE2文件中取消关于`NamesAreUniqueValidator`注释,然后运行MWE2工作流即可生效。当尝试创建具有重复名称的实体时,IDE将显示相应错误信息。 自定义验证器是实现DSL特定约束的关键。虽然默认验证器处理一些常见情况,但复杂检查需要根据DSL语义来定制。这包括创建新的验证器类,继承Xtext提供的基类,并覆盖相关方法以执行自定义逻辑。第9章和第10章将进一步解释如何实现这些自定义验证器以及它们在类型检查与名称作用域等更复杂问题中的应用。 通过自定义验证器,开发者能确保DSL用户遵循特定业务规则(如限制某些操作的可用性、数据有效性或实施编码标准)。这有助于捕获解析器无法检测到的错误,提高代码质量,并提供即时反馈。因此,Xtext成为开发专业级DSL工具的理想框架。